Iran’s New Supreme Leader Calls for Continued Closure of Strait of Hormuz
Iran’s newly appointed Supreme Leader Mojtaba Khamenei declared that the Strait of Hormuz should remain closed, describing the move as an important instrument for exerting pressure on Iran’s adversaries. His remarks, broadcast on state television and translated by Reuters, mark his first public address since assuming the country’s highest religious and political office.
At 17, Mojtaba Khamenei Built Network That Made Him Iran's Supreme Leader
On March 8 2026, ten days after US-Israeli strikes killed his father, Mojtaba Khamenei was appointed Iran's third supreme leader. At 56, he became the most powerful figure in a country of 90 million people, at war and under siege.

Iranian Officials Seek To Quell Rumors About Supreme Leader Mojtaba Khamenei's Health
Iranian officials went on the offensive on March 11 to knock down rumors over newly appointed Supreme Leader Mojtaba Khamenei's state of health, saying he was injured in the air strikes that killed his father and other family members, but is "safe and sound."
Mojtaba Khamenei as Iran's new Supreme Leader signals continuity to international community
Amid the political uncertainty surrounding Mojtaba Khamenei, Iran's new Supreme Leader, Nadia Massih is pleased to welcome Dr Anahita Motazed Rad, Visiting Senior Fellow at the London School of Economics. As the Islamic Republic navigates a moment of acute pressure, the elevation of Mojtaba Khamenei serves an important political function, explains Dr Motazed Rad. By maintaining him as the formal leader, the regime sends a message to both domestic elites and the international community that institutional cohesion remains intact during a time of war.

Commercial Ships Hit In Strait Of Hormuz After US Targets Iranian Mine-Laying Vessels
Iran has seen 16 of its mine-laying ships attacked in the Strait of Hormuz, according to US Central Command, which released footage of several strikes on the vessels. The ships were hit on March 10, US officials say, following warnings by US President Donald Trump to Iran.
